home *** CD-ROM | disk | FTP | other *** search
/ CICA 1993 December / CICA_Shareware_for_Windows_CD-ROM_Walnut_Creek_December_1993.iso / win3 / patches / upda.exe / README.TXT < prev    next >
Text File  |  1993-07-13  |  13KB  |  297 lines

  1. IMPROV FOR WINDOWS, RELEASE 2.1 - RELEASE NOTES
  2.  
  3. This document contains notes about Improv(R) Release 2.1.
  4. The notes describe problems you might encounter and 
  5. provide information not available in the Improv Handbook,
  6. Improv in Action, and the Help systems. To print this 
  7. document, choose File Print.
  8.  
  9. NEW FEATURES
  10. WK4 Import/Export-- Improv can now import and export 
  11. 1-2-3(R) files in WK4 format. For more complete information
  12. search in Help under "Importing."
  13.  
  14. Working Together Icons-- Improv now has a set of SmartIcons
  15. that allow you to launch other Lotus applications from 
  16. within Improv.  For more complete information search in 
  17. Help under "Customizing SmartIcons" for "Using the Working 
  18. Together SmartIcons Set." 
  19.  
  20. Notes Data Exchange-- Improv can now exchange data with 
  21. Lotus Notes(R). Improv supports text, numbers, and date/time 
  22. numbers in editable Notes fields. For more complete information
  23. search in Help under "Data exchange."
  24.  
  25. INSTALL
  26. 1. If your system is running the DOS SHARE utility when 
  27. you install Improv, then the Improv Install program will 
  28. be unable to delete a temporary file named INSTMAIN.EXE, 
  29. which is located in the subdirectory named LOTUSTMP, 
  30. which is located in your Windows directory. After you 
  31. complete the Install program, manually delete the file 
  32. INSTMAIN.EXE and then remove the LOTUSTMP directory.
  33.  
  34. 2. For Server installations, after setting up the \Lotshare
  35. directory, create a subdirectory named \Improv.v20. This
  36. directory will contain the license files. The full path
  37. will be \Lotshare\Improv.v20.
  38.  
  39. IMPROV GUIDED TOUR
  40. 1. For optimal viewing of the Guided Tour, before you 
  41. launch Improv for the first time, turn off any screen 
  42. saver program and switch to the Windows 3.1 VGA display 
  43. driver.
  44.  
  45. 2. Improv attempts to load the Guided Tour the first time 
  46. that you launch the program. If you delete the Guided Tour 
  47. before launching Improv for the first time, be sure to 
  48. change the following line in the IMPROV.INI file, which is 
  49. located in your Windows directory: Change FirstTime=YES to 
  50. FirstTime=NO. Changing this line prevents Improv from 
  51. trying to launch the tour.
  52.  
  53. SAMPLE SCRIPTS
  54. The following sample library scripts are provided in the 
  55. Scripts directory.  To find out more about how these 
  56. scripts work, open the .LSS files and read the descriptive 
  57. comments in the scripts. The scripts marked with an asterisk
  58. (*) are attached to SmartIcons.
  59. *COLORCEL.LSS - Allows you to assign colors to cells, based 
  60. on their values. There is an option to color "All Cells on 
  61. Recalc." When the option is checked, each time the worksheet
  62. recalculates, the script checks every cell value. To turn 
  63. this option off,  run the script again, and uncheck the 
  64. option.
  65. *LOADTMPL.LSS - Allows you to view a dialog box that lets 
  66. you choose from a list of worksheet templates to open. 
  67. *ADDINS20.LSS - Registers the add-in @functions for use in
  68. formulas.
  69. SEARCH.LSS - Allows you to search for and/or replace cell 
  70. values or text of formulas.
  71. SCRPUTIL.LSS - Includes a set of utilities for writing 
  72. Improv applications in LotusScript.
  73.  
  74. DEFAULT PATHS
  75. When specifying default paths in the Default Paths dialog 
  76. box (Tools\User Setup\Paths), do not enter a trailing 
  77. backslash at the end of a subdirectory path.  For example, 
  78. enter C:\IMPROV\MYFILES, not C:\IMPROV\MYFILES\. All root 
  79. directories must end with a backslash.  For example, enter 
  80. D:\.
  81.  
  82. PRINTING
  83. 1. Multi-line text in a model may appear truncated when 
  84. you print to an HP LaserJet III.  To correct this, check 
  85. Send TrueType as Graphics in the Options panel of the 
  86. Print Setup dialog box and then print the model.
  87.  
  88. 2. Settings on the Print Setup dialog box--for example, 
  89. paper size--are not saved with the Improv model. If you 
  90. open an existing model and notice, for example, that the 
  91. layout of a presentation has changed, check the paper size 
  92. specified in the Print Setup dialog box.
  93.  
  94. 3. If you set worksheet grid line styles to double lines, 
  95. the space between the lines may not appear in a print 
  96. preview. However, the lines will print correctly.
  97.  
  98. LOTUS CHART(TM)
  99. 1. If you get the message "Cannot create a chart" when 
  100. you open a file containing charts, do not save the file 
  101. or you will lose the charts previously contained in the 
  102. file. Instead, when you get the message, click the Explain 
  103. button to get more information about resolving the problem. 
  104. Then close the file without saving it.
  105.  
  106. 2. The only information that is linked between the 
  107. worksheet and a chart is the data that you plot. The 
  108. legend names and X-axis names are not linked. Therefore, 
  109. if you edit an item name, the chart does not update to 
  110. reflect the new name.
  111.  
  112. 3. To cut and paste data and keep a chart of that data 
  113. updated, cut and paste the cells only. If you cut and paste 
  114. items, the chart does not update. 
  115.  
  116. 4. The High-Low-Close-Open (HLCO) chart layouts that have 
  117. bars at the bottom and lines at the top will not display 
  118. correctly unless the chart has five or six data series.
  119.  
  120. 5. The High-Low-Close-Open (HLCO) chart layouts that have 
  121. no bars at the bottom or lines at the top will not display 
  122. correctly unless the chart has four or fewer data series.
  123.  
  124. 6. If you enter a maximum value for the chart scale, the 
  125. chart may not display it if there is not enough room.  
  126. To correct this, enlarge the chart vertically, change the 
  127. major ticks value, or change the minimum value.
  128.  
  129. 7. You cannot format the series labels in a pie chart. 
  130. The series labels for other chart types take their format 
  131. from the Y-axis label format.
  132.  
  133. 8. In a 3D chart, the X-axis tick labels may overlap or 
  134. appear truncated. To correct this, enlarge the plot of the 
  135. chart or assign a font in a smaller point size to the X-axis.
  136.  
  137. 9. Assigning some fonts to the Y-axis title in a chart 
  138. results in horizontal text rather than vertical text 
  139. appearing in the print preview; however, the printout 
  140. appears correctly.  These fonts include FixedSys, Helvetica 
  141. Narrow, MS Sans Serif, MS Serif, Palatino, System, and 
  142. ZapfChancery.
  143.  
  144. FONTS
  145. 1. To assign a font size that is not listed in the InfoBox 
  146. or on the status bar, you must use LotusScript--for example, 
  147. use the command SetIntProperty(0, TextSize, 72) to specify 
  148. a 72-point font. In header/footer text, enter a format code 
  149. to specify the desired font --for example, {F 72}.
  150.  
  151. 2. Improv does not support SuperText and SuperPrint 
  152. (Releases 1.1, 1.2, 2.0, 2.1) from Zenographics.
  153.  
  154. TEXT EXPORT
  155. If you export an unsaved file to a text file, there is no 
  156. limit to the size of the file you can export. If you export 
  157. a saved file to a text file, you can export a maximum of 
  158. 8192 rows and 256 columns.
  159.  
  160. FILE IMPORT
  161. 1. Remove password protection from a file before you 
  162. import the file into Improv.
  163.  
  164. 2. Remove embedded charts and graphic objects from a 
  165. Microsoft(R) Excel 4.0 file before you import the file 
  166. into Improv.
  167.  
  168. 3. When you import a 1-2-3 or Excel file that contains 
  169. many formulas, the import may take a long time. To import 
  170. the worksheet faster, don't import the formulas.  To do 
  171. this, uncheck Import Formulas in the Worksheet Import 
  172. dialog box.
  173.  
  174. 4. When you import a 1-2-3 or Excel file, most functions 
  175. will be translated into their Improv equivalents; however, 
  176. you may need to recreate some manually after you import 
  177. the file. For more information, see Appendix B of the 
  178. Improv Handbook, which lists 1-2-3 and Excel functions and 
  179. their Improv equivalents.
  180.  
  181. 5. Improv can import Excel 4.0 files. If you upgraded from 
  182. Excel 3.0 to Excel 4.0, you must save Excel 3.0 files as 
  183. Excel 4.0 files before you import them into Improv. 
  184.  
  185. DDE LINKS
  186. A DDE link may break without warning if Improv is the 
  187. server and you rename, group, or ungroup items that are 
  188. included in a linked selection. If the link breaks, 
  189. delete the link formula and recreate the link.
  190.  
  191. COLLATE OPTIONS
  192. In the International dialog box (Tools/UserSetup/International),
  193. the ASCII option actually displays the ANSI character set.
  194.  
  195. LOTUSSCRIPT
  196. 1. Be aware of the following issues with scripts that use 
  197. the CloseModel or CloseIWindow functions to close models:
  198. a) If you have a library script that closes the model it is 
  199. attached to, do not attach it to a model. Instead, use a 
  200. model script for this purpose. 
  201. b) Do not debug a library or model script that uses
  202. the CloseModel function to close the file that contains 
  203. the script.
  204.  
  205. 2. Within a script, reading files from a floppy device 
  206. that is not ready and then choosing the Cancel option from 
  207. a "Drive not ready" message will cause Improv and Windows 
  208. to crash. To work around this problem, scripts should first 
  209. include another file operation that checks the drive to make 
  210. sure that it is ready. For example, include the dir$ 
  211. function in the script, along with a way to exit the script 
  212. if the dir$ fails. Then if the drive is not ready, choosing 
  213. Cancel will succeed, but the dir$ will fail and the script 
  214. will stop. If the drive is ready, the script can continue 
  215. with the file operation that you originally wanted to perform.
  216.  
  217. 3. If you do not use U.S. as your International country 
  218. setting, you should note the following. Using "\$" within 
  219. the second argument to the format$ function will cause the 
  220. "$" to appear at the beginning of the resulting text--for 
  221. example, print format$(1234.56,"#,###.##\$") will print 
  222. $1,234.56. If you want the "$" trailing the text, use print 
  223. format$(1234.56,"#,###.##")+"$" which will print 1,234.56$.
  224.  
  225. 4. In scripts, use the float data type to store Improv cell 
  226. values. Use the SetLongDoubleCellValue and 
  227. GetLongDoubleCellValue functions in place of SetCellValue 
  228. and GetCellValue to set and get Improv cell data. This will 
  229. avoid rounding errors due to the conversion of 8 byte data 
  230. to 10 byte data.
  231.  
  232. 5. GetBrowserNote doesn't work when the selection is a model 
  233. script.
  234.  
  235. 6. GetSelection doesn't work when the selection is a library 
  236. script.
  237.  
  238. 7.  Do not assign the same name to two scripts in the same 
  239. script library file. This includes scripts with the same 
  240. names and different capitalization. For example, do not name 
  241. two scripts SCRIPT1 and script1.
  242.  
  243. 8.  After deleting or renaming a script name in the Script 
  244. Name box of the script library window, you must press Enter.
  245.  
  246. 9. Do not debug a script (Tools/Run Script/Debug) containing 
  247. the command CreateChart or CmdExec(xcmd_CreateChart). Instead, 
  248. insert a STOP statement in the script after these commands. 
  249. Then to debug the script, run the script. The STOP statement 
  250. will invoke the Debug window, and you will be able to debug 
  251. the script from that point.
  252.  
  253. 10. In Script Help, the description of the parameters for the
  254. GetStringProperty is incorrect. Use the parameter IT_CONTEXT1 
  255. to find the view/presentation/script name; use the parameter 
  256. IT_CONTEXT2 to find the worksheet name.
  257.  
  258. SCRIPT RECORDING AND PLAYBACK
  259. 1. Recorded scripts may have references to the specific 
  260. model that was operated on. To use the script on a different 
  261. view, worksheet, or model or to make the script more general, 
  262. edit the lines before running the recorded script.
  263.  
  264. 2. You cannot generalize a script that records changes to
  265. settings of graphic objects in Presentations because the 
  266. names of the objects are generated by Improv.
  267.  
  268. 3. The option to replace data with calculated values when 
  269. adding a formula does not get recorded. When you run the 
  270. script, the formula will be created, but the data values 
  271. will not be replaced. To work around this problem, record 
  272. clearing the cell values first and then create the formula.
  273.  
  274. 4. When recording moving between views, opening the Browser 
  275. will always be recorded. To move between views without 
  276. opening the Browser, change the SetSelectionByName function 
  277. call in the recorded script to CreateSelHandle, use the 
  278. OpenIWindow command on the selection, and remove the script 
  279. text that opens the Browser.
  280.  
  281. 5. When editing text, operations such as Cut, Copy, and 
  282. Paste  are not recorded. All that is recorded is the 
  283. resulting edited text.
  284.  
  285. LOTUS DIALOG EDITOR
  286. Do not use hard carriage returns when entering text for 
  287. buttons or text boxes. Instead, resize the control to allow 
  288. the text to wrap.
  289.  
  290. C API
  291. The Scripts directory contains an import library file
  292. (LIBPL.LIB) and a header file (CAPI_PUB.H) for C API users. 
  293. To call into the Improv C API interface, create a Windows 
  294. .DLL file that includes the CAPI_PUB.H (Improv C API 
  295. prototypes) and links with LIBPL.LIB (Improv C API import 
  296. library).
  297.